    Factors Influencing the Cost

    Several factors contribute to the cost of hair transplant surgery:

    1. Extent of Hair Loss: The more extensive the hair loss, the more grafts are needed, which can increase the overall cost.
    2. Technique Used: Methods like Follicular Unit Transplantation (FUT) and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E) have different costs associated with them. FUE, which is less invasive and more popular, tends to be more expensive.
    3. Surgeon's Expertise: Renowned surgeons with extensive experience may charge higher fees, but their expertise can significantly enhance the results.
    4. Additional Costs: Post-operative care, medications, and follow-up appointments can add to the overall expense.

    Understanding the Cost of Hair Transplant Surgery in Vancouver, BC, Canada

    When considering hair transplant surgery in Vancouver, BC, Canada, it's important to understand that the cost can vary significantly based on several factors. As a medical professional in this field, I aim to provide you with a comprehensive overview to help you make an informed decision.

    Factors Influencing the Cost

    Several elements contribute to the overall cost of hair transplant surgery. These include:

    1. Type of Procedure: The two main types of hair transplant procedures are Follicular Unit Transplantation (FUT) and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E). FUE tends to be more expensive due to its minimally invasive nature and the precision required.

    2. Number of Grafts: The cost is often calculated per graft. The more grafts needed, the higher the cost. Typically, each graft can range from $5 to $12, depending on the clinic and the surgeon's expertise.

    3. Surgeon's Expertise: Renowned surgeons with extensive experience and successful track records may charge higher fees. However, this investment can be worthwhile for the quality of the results and the overall experience.

    4. Clinic's Location: The geographical location of the clinic can also affect the cost. Clinics in major cities like Vancouver may have higher overheads, which can be reflected in the pricing.

    Average Cost Range

    On average, hair transplant surgery in Vancouver, BC, Canada, can range from $4,000 to $15,000. This wide range is due to the variability in the factors mentioned above. For instance, a smaller procedure with around 1,000 grafts might cost around $4,000, while a more extensive procedure requiring 3,000 grafts could reach up to $15,000.

    Additional Costs to Consider

    Apart from the surgical fees, there are other costs to keep in mind:

    • Pre-operative Consultations: These are essential for assessing your suitability for the procedure and can range from $100 to $300.
    • Post-operative Care: This includes medications, follow-up appointments, and any necessary touch-up procedures, which can add several hundred dollars to the total cost.
    • Travel and Accommodation: If you are traveling from Edmonton to Vancouver for the surgery, you will need to factor in travel and accommodation expenses.
